Summary
Colorado Community College is set to develop an innovative apprenticeship model aimed at enhancing workforce training and education. This initiative reflects a growing commitment to integrating practical experience with academic learning in the state of Colorado.
As workforce development continues to evolve, such programs are crucial in preparing individuals for skilled trades and helping companies find qualified talent. The focus on apprenticeships points to a significant trend in bridging the gap between education and employment.
